Tetra colorbits are sold as Tetra prima in the UK.

Yes, they can be fed to plecos but be very careful to only feed a little. The food expands a lot in water and if the catfish eat a lot quickly, it can expand quickly and kill them. I have lost plecos to this in the past. In my case it was loricaria and ancistrus that I learned from the hard way.
